gnome-scan r674 - in trunk: . modules/gsane



Author: bersace
Date: Sun Dec 14 13:54:49 2008
New Revision: 674
URL: http://svn.gnome.org/viewvc/gnome-scan?rev=674&view=rev

Log:
Added GSaneScanner::reload-options signal.

Modified:
   trunk/ChangeLog
   trunk/modules/gsane/gsane-scanner.c

Modified: trunk/modules/gsane/gsane-scanner.c
==============================================================================
--- trunk/modules/gsane/gsane-scanner.c	(original)
+++ trunk/modules/gsane/gsane-scanner.c	Sun Dec 14 13:54:49 2008
@@ -140,13 +140,13 @@
 	}
 
 	sane_control_option(self->priv->handle, 0, SANE_ACTION_GET_VALUE, &count,NULL);
-	g_debug("Device %s : %i SANE options", self->priv->sane_id, count);
+	g_debug("Device %s : %i options", self->priv->sane_id, count);
 
 	for (n = 1; n < count; n++) {
 		desc = sane_get_option_descriptor(self->priv->handle, n);
 		switch(desc->type) {
 		case SANE_TYPE_GROUP:
-			g_debug("Group %s", dgettext("sane-backends", desc->title));
+			g_debug("Group \"%s\"", dgettext("sane-backends", desc->title));
 			group = desc->title;
 			break;
 		case SANE_TYPE_BUTTON:
@@ -244,6 +244,7 @@
 	o_class->set_property	= gsane_scanner_set_property;
 	g_object_class_install_property(o_class, GSANE_SCANNER_SANE_ID, g_param_spec_string("sane-id", "SANE ID",  "SANE device id", NULL,G_PARAM_WRITABLE|G_PARAM_CONSTRUCT_ONLY));
 	g_object_class_install_property(o_class, GSANE_SCANNER_SANE_TYPE, g_param_spec_string("sane-type", "SANE Type", "SANE device type", NULL, G_PARAM_WRITABLE|G_PARAM_CONSTRUCT_ONLY));
+	g_signal_new("reload-options", GSANE_TYPE_SCANNER, G_SIGNAL_RUN_LAST, 0, NULL, NULL, g_cclosure_marshal_VOID__VOID, G_TYPE_NONE, 0);
 }
 
 



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]